My Husband’s Woman (1970)
When her friend Nany convinces her that she is sick, Samya goes in for a checkup and discovers that she is about to die. Samya decides to pick a bride for her husband to marry after she dies.
Director: Mahmoud Zulfiqar
Genre: Comedy, Drama
Runtime: 110 min
Release Date: April 27, 1970
